How much do machine shop manager j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 1, 2026, the average yearly pay for machine shop manager in Lamar, SC is $69,727.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$53,000.00 and $82,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a machine shop manager do?

A Machine Shop Manager oversees the daily operations of a machine shop, ensuring that production schedules are met, equipment is maintained, and safety standards are followed. They are responsible for managing staff, coordinating workflow, and optimizing manufacturing processes. Additionally, they handle budgeting, inventory control, and quality assurance to maintain efficient and cost-effective operations. The role often involves liaising with other departments to meet production goals and address any technical challenges.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a machine shop man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Machine Shop Manager, you need strong expertise in machining processes, production management, and a background in mechanical engineering or manufacturing, often supported by relevant degrees or certifications. Familiarity with CNC machines, CAD/CAM software, ERP systems, and safety regulations is typically required. Leadership, effective communication, and problem-solving skills are crucial for managing teams and driving continuous improvement. These competencies ensure efficient operations, high-quality output, and a safe, productive work environment.

What is the difference between Machine Shop Manager vs Machinist?

AspectMachine Shop ManagerMachinist
Primary RoleOversees shop operations, manages staff, and ensures production efficiencyOperates machine tools to produce precision parts
CredentialsOften requires management experience, technical skills, and certificationsTypically needs technical training or certifications in machining
Work EnvironmentOffice and shop floor management, supervisory tasksHands-on machine operation in manufacturing settings
Industry UsageUsed in manufacturing, metalworking, and industrial facilitiesCommonly found in machine shops, manufacturing plants

The main difference is that a Machine Shop Manager oversees the entire operation, including staff and workflow, while a Machinist focuses on operating machines to produce parts. Both roles require technical knowledge, but the manager's role is more supervisory and administrative.

Job description

Material Handler

The Material Handler maintains production and distribution of product by pulling orders from inventory, delivering production material and supplies, and staging finished product. This includes consolidating and packing materials for shipments. The Material Handler position is critical for the fulfillment of the additional material time (AMT) orders for out of service elevators and company warranty of contracts. This position interacts with quality, specifiers, customer service and every line in the Florence plant to support elevator mechanics and superintends. The Material Handler performs duties such as receiving, inspecting, storing, pulling and shipping, products to the customer. In addition, they are responsible for cycle counting and performing inventory adjustments. The Material Handler will participates in daily toolbox meetings and ensures shop floor management elements such as Tier 1, QCPC, 5S, MRB and other job duties assigned are completed effectively. This position is in the Warehouse.

Shift: 3rd Shift

Hours: 7:30PM-6:00AM (Sun-Thurs & additional days as needed)

Essential Responsibilities:

  • Accurately fill the kit carts by printing and following the appropriate pick list. Complete all inventory transactions associated with the picklist and point of use parts using the DSI scanner. Close all pick list immediately after kitting.
  • Complete all put away and restock bins in the designated area within 24 hours of receipt of product.
  • Identify all material shortages or low stock items and report them to the supervisor. Cycle Count assigned locations and report any discrepancy to the supervisor.
  • Complete 5s and housekeeping assignments
  • Participate in required Level I OJT and cross-training on Level II Material Handler.
  • Perform other duties as requested or assigned by supervisor or manager.

Critical Skills

  • Basic reading, writing, and math ability. Knowledge of computer applications and use of product documents to ensure product compliance. Effective communication skills to drive improvement in defect prevention and flexibility to foster learning all Level 1 and 2 products/stations and cell configurations. Ability to train others in product configurations to drive cross-training and knowledge transfer.
  • Material Handling Practices- Knowledge of proper material storage and Kanban systems.
  • PIV- Not required
  • DSI- Working knowledge of the main scripts for the Supermarket operations.
  • Warehousing- Ability to cycle count, complete inventory transfers, store product by line and location, and kit according to picklist. Must have a basic understanding of the Kanban process.
  • Public Safety and Security - Knowledge of relevant equipment, policies, procedures, and strategies to promote effective local, state, or national security operations for the protection of people, data, property, and institutions.
  • Mechanical - Knowledge of machines and tools (Banding machine, strap, including their designs, uses, repair, and maintenance.
  • Operation and Control - Controlling operations of equipment or systems.

Education / Certifications

High School Diploma or GED.

Minimum Experience

  • 0-1 years of PIV Operation, Warehouse experience, Shipping and Receiving experience.
  • 1 year warehouse experience in a pick/pack operation, 1 years' experience with warehouse management systems (DSI/JDE).

Physical Demands:

  • Must be able to lift 35 lbs.
  • Must be able to stand up to 10 hours a day
